Output ec16283b1ab6185a093a7e89c9d335c3f3532f26d3b9deeb8490bde952931678:13

value
1718573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d2d55791b7d8423afe9825b8f0775ecc70815b OP_EQUAL
address
32QPDr1MmN39EoeCc4JDTELdXbKhBpVMQj
transaction
ec16283b1ab6185a093a7e89c9d335c3f3532f26d3b9deeb8490bde952931678
confirmations
236767
spent
true